well, let's notice at the coordinates for A and B, A(-2 , 1) and B(1 , -1)


~~~~~~~~~~~~\textit{distance between 2 points} \\\\ A(\stackrel{x_1}{-2}~,~\stackrel{y_1}{1})\qquad B(\stackrel{x_2}{1}~,~\stackrel{y_2}{-1})\qquad \qquad d = √(( x_2- x_1)^2 + ( y_2- y_1)^2) \\\\\\ AB=√([1 - (-2)]^2 + [-1 - 1]^2)\implies AB=√((1+2)^2+(-2)^2) \\\\\\ AB=√(9+4)\implies AB=√(13)\implies AB\approx 3.6
